How to learn how to actually *converse* in Spanish. by thro0away12 in Spanish

[–]jlap1n 14 points15 points  (0 children)

First things first you need to start consuming content in Spanish. The only way to practice your listening comprehension is by listening. A lot of people start out with beginner/intermediate level comprehensible input videos (these can be found on YouTube or by watching children's shows) and then slowly working your way up to content aimed at native speakers.

There are also platforms online to practice speaking with people, but as I haven't used them at all I will leave that to other people to elaborate on.

What place has the most “atypical” temperatures for their latitude? by WWDB in geography

[–]jlap1n 40 points41 points  (0 children)

Tropical highland climates are fascinating. Check the climate of La Paz, Bolivia if you want to see a really cool illustration of how much heat moist air can hold, the low temperatures fluctuate greatly from wet to dry season while the highs do not.
